Enabling Independence N-702-7021Condition: BRAND NEW ISBN: 9781405130288 Year: 2006 Publisher: John Wiley & Sons (UK) Pages: 360 Description: This book is designed as a companion text for the variety of support workers in the field of rehabilitation. It recognises the diversity of roles and array of training and education options; formal routes such as S NVQ and schemes which are tailored to an individual workplace.
